- How Water Pipe Detectors WorkPlastic water pipes are commonly used in residential and commercial buildings for supplying water. However, locating these pipes can be a challenging task, especially when they are buried underground or within walls. This is where water pipe detectors come in handy.
A water pipe detector is a specialized tool that uses advanced technology to locate plastic water pipes. These devices work by emitting electromagnetic signals that are able to penetrate through various materials, such as soil, concrete, and insulation. Once the signal comes into contact with a plastic water pipe, it is reflected back to the detector, indicating the exact location of the pipe.
One of the main components of a water pipe detector is the transmitter, which is used to send out the electromagnetic signal. The transmitter is connected to the pipe by a cable or clamp, allowing it to accurately detect the location of the pipe. The receiver is another important component of the detector, which is used to pick up the signal and provide feedback to the user.
When using a water pipe detector, it is important to follow certain steps to ensure accurate results. The detector should be calibrated before use to ensure that it is properly tuned to detect plastic water pipes. It is also important to scan the area in a systematic manner, moving the detector slowly across the surface to accurately pinpoint the location of the pipes.
In addition to detecting the presence of plastic water pipes, water pipe detectors are also able to determine the depth of the pipes. By analyzing the strength of the signal and the angle at which it is reflected, the detector is able to provide an estimate of the pipe's depth. This information is crucial for avoiding potential damage to the pipes during construction or renovation projects.

- Step-by-Step Guide to Using a Water Pipe DetectorPlastic water pipes are a popular choice for many homeowners and businesses due to their durability, affordability, and ease of installation. However, detecting these pipes can be a challenging task, especially when they are buried beneath the ground or behind walls. This is where a water pipe detector comes in handy. In this comprehensive guide, we will walk you through the step-by-step process of using a water pipe detector to locate plastic water pipes in your home or property.
Step 1: Familiarize Yourself with the Water Pipe Detector
Before you begin using a water pipe detector, it is crucial to familiarize yourself with the device. Most water pipe detectors operate using electromagnetic technology, which allows them to detect the presence of metal or plastic pipes beneath the surface. Take the time to read the user manual and understand how to operate the detector effectively.
Step 2: Prepare the Area for Detection
Before you start scanning for plastic water pipes, it is essential to prepare the area by removing any obstacles or debris that may interfere with the detector's readings. Clear out the space and ensure there are no metal objects nearby that could cause false readings.
Step 3: Calibrate the Water Pipe Detector
Calibrating the water pipe detector is a crucial step in ensuring accurate readings. Follow the manufacturer's instructions to set the detector to the appropriate sensitivity level for detecting plastic water pipes. This may involve adjusting the settings based on the depth of the pipes and surrounding materials.
Step 4: Scan the Area
Once the water pipe detector is calibrated, you can begin scanning the area for plastic water pipes. Hold the detector close to the ground and move it slowly across the surface in a systematic pattern. Pay close attention to any beeps or indicators on the detector that signal the presence of a water pipe.
Step 5: Confirm the Findings
After detecting a potential plastic water pipe, it is essential to confirm the findings by conducting additional scans from different angles. Make a note of the location and depth of the pipe to help with future maintenance or renovations.
Using a water pipe detector to locate plastic water pipes can save time, effort, and money by avoiding unnecessary digging or damage to existing infrastructure. By following this step-by-step guide, you can effectively detect and locate plastic water pipes in your home or property with ease. - Common Mistakes to Avoid When Using a Water Pipe DetectorCommon Mistakes to Avoid When Using a Water Pipe Detector
When it comes to detecting plastic water pipes, using a water pipe detector can be a useful tool. However, there are some common mistakes that many people make when using this equipment. In this guide, we will explore these mistakes and provide tips on how to avoid them to ensure accurate and successful detection of plastic water pipes.
One of the most common mistakes that people make when using a water pipe detector is not calibrating the equipment properly. It is essential to calibrate the detector before each use to ensure accurate readings. Failure to do so can result in false readings and misidentifying the location of plastic water pipes. To calibrate the detector, simply follow the manufacturer's instructions and perform the necessary steps before beginning your detection process.
Another mistake that people often make when using a water pipe detector is not understanding how the equipment works. It is crucial to familiarize yourself with the functions and settings of the detector to ensure effective detection of plastic water pipes. Take the time to read the user manual and practice using the equipment in different environments to become comfortable with its operation. This will help you avoid errors and improve your success rate in locating plastic water pipes.
Using the wrong detection mode is another common mistake that can lead to inaccurate results when searching for plastic water pipes. Different detectors offer various modes for detecting different materials, so it is important to select the appropriate mode for detecting plastic water pipes. Make sure to consult the detector's user manual to determine the best mode for your specific needs and adjust the settings accordingly for optimal detection.
Overlooking environmental factors is another common mistake that can impact the accuracy of your plastic water pipe detection. Factors such as subsoil composition, moisture levels, and interference from other buried utilities can affect the performance of the detector. Take these factors into consideration when using the water pipe detector and adjust your detection technique accordingly to ensure reliable results.
Neglecting to mark the detected location of plastic water pipes is another mistake that can hinder your detection process. Once you have located a plastic water pipe using the detector, be sure to mark the spot accurately to avoid confusion or damage during excavation. Use a marking tool such as spray paint or flags to indicate the exact location of the pipe for future reference.
In conclusion, by avoiding these common mistakes when using a water pipe detector for detecting plastic water pipes, you can improve the accuracy and efficiency of your detection process. Remember to calibrate the equipment, understand how it works, use the correct detection mode, consider environmental factors, and mark detected locations to ensure successful detection of plastic water pipes.
